Could Sore Throat And Aching Teeth And Gums Be Symptoms Of Cancer?
Hi, I had an ear infection few weeks ago. Had antibiotics but after couple weeks it returned. Initially my teeth or gums (not sure which) were aching too but now it s reverse the teeth/gums hurt more with just odd occasional ear pain. This is both sides by the way. I m worried now as my tongue feels but sore and have that yellowish colour at roof of mouth. Have slightly sore throat too. My dentist checked teeth and said all was ok. I m so worried as I ve read so much about throat/mouth cancer :( I ve also had discoloured tongue. Can u possibly give me any reassurance or do I need to see GP again? Thank you
As per your complain the symptoms of aching teeth/gums along with yellowish roof of mouth and sore throat and occasional ear ache are pointing towards sinus infection or sinusitis. As the sinuses lies in close association with upper jaw teeth therefore sinus infection causes pain in teeth and gums. Occasional ear ache is indicative of lingering ear infection while can be radiating pain from sinuses.
I would suggest you to consult an Otolaryngologist and get examined. He can advise you PNS VIEW x ray of sinuses or MRI scan to confirm the cause and treatment can be done accordingly. You can be advised to take a course of antibiotics, anti inflammatory painkiller like Ibuprofen, doing warm saline gargles, steam inhalation and do saline nasal irrigation. Avoid air conditioned atmosphere. Do warm compresses over the area surrounding nose.
